About Nachi Parallel Shank Drills



Nachi Parallel Shank Drills are designed for precision and durability in industrial applications. Crafted from high-speed steel, these drills offer exceptional strength and reliability while maintaining rust-proof properties to ensure long-lasting performance. The parallel shank design enhances stability and grip, making it ideal for manual operation. Available in a versatile size range of 3mm to 17mm, these drills cater to various drilling needs across industries. The sleek silver color adds a modern touch to the robust design, making them suitable for professional use. Specifically engineered to provide accurate and efficient drilling, Nachi Parallel Shank Drills are an essential tool for professionals seeking high-quality and dependable solutions.
